1. Silicon Dioxide

Silicon dioxide remains a fundamental material in the electronics sector, primarily used in semiconductor fabrication. Its ability to serve as an insulator and protect electronic components from environmental factors solidifies its importance. With the rise of 5G technology and increased demand for efficient chips, the application of silicon dioxide is projected to grow significantly.

2. Gallium Nitride (GaN)

Gallium nitride is emerging as a superior alternative to silicon for power electronics. Known for its efficiency and higher thermal conductivity, GaN is ideal for power amplifiers in RF applications and power conversion systems. As renewable energy sources and electric vehicles gain traction, GaN's usage is expected to surge in the coming years.

3. Graphene

Graphene has captured the attention of researchers and manufacturers due to its extraordinary conductivity and strength. While it's still in the experimental stages for many applications, its potential for use in flexible electronics and advanced batteries positions it as a significant material to watch in 2025. Innovations in graphene production techniques will likely enhance its adoption in consumer electronics.

4. Indium Tin Oxide (ITO)

Indium tin oxide continues to be a leading transparent conducting oxide used in touchscreens, flat panel displays, and solar cells. The shift towards more energy-efficient and sustainable technologies will boost the demand for ITO, although there are ongoing efforts to find environmentally friendly alternatives.

Conductive polymers, such as polyaniline and polypyrrole, show great promise in various electronic applications including organic photovoltaic cells and flexible displays. Their lightweight nature and potential for low-cost production make them ideal candidates for next-generation electronics. As research in this area flourishes, we can expect a rise in their utilization across many electronic devices.

6. Lithium Compounds

The demand for lithium compounds is closely tied to the booming electric vehicle and renewable energy markets. Lithium-ion batteries are at the forefront of energy storage solutions, making lithium a crucial chemical in electronics. Research is ongoing to improve battery technology, and advancements in lithium extraction will likely shape its future availability and sustainability.

7. Cobalt

Cobalt plays a significant role in the production of lithium-ion batteries, enhancing energy density and longevity. However, due to ethical concerns surrounding mining processes, the industry is exploring alternatives and recycling methods to ensure a sustainable supply. Its importance is set to increase alongside the growing electric vehicle market.

8. Rare Earth Elements

Rare earth elements are essential for producing high-performance magnets and phosphors in various electronic devices. As technological advancements demand smaller and more efficient components, the usage of these elements is expected to grow, prompting a focus on ethical sourcing and recycling methodologies in the electronics industry.
